1) He'll be 27 in June 2009, and last time I checked a basketball players prime is from 27-30.
2) Shaq sells tickets, even if we're not winning games.
3) With a lotto pick this year we'll have a much better shot at winning it all. The Shaq era is over, but that doesn't mean we should give him away for someone like Marbury. It would cost the franchise at least the 20 million we're saving. No one likes Starbury. People still like Shaq. 1 Year of savings isn't worth that. Especially because the 2009 FA class doesn't even compare to the 2010 one, which is WAY better! We can wait one year...
